Transaction ed4c96b63ec0cd68882bc1dcb20cd0dfb5983716279afd5866357f8e607c7edc
1 Input
2 Outputs
- ed4c96b63ec0cd68882bc1dcb20cd0dfb5983716279afd5866357f8e607c7edc:0
- ed4c96b63ec0cd68882bc1dcb20cd0dfb5983716279afd5866357f8e607c7edc:1
value 27761393
address 1ESyuM7stciJKFctjJSfChzXBo6HTg5ynU
value 1699360
address 3ChNaGmDefJE432DkQgBLwE6XzP4JniWHa